Ø Buffer capacity can be defined in many ways, it can be defined as: The number of moles of H+/OH- ions that must be added to one litre of the buffer in order to decrease /increase the pH by one unit respectively. Potassium phosphate buffers, sometimes called Gomori buffers, consist of a mixture of monobasic dihydrogen phosphate and dibasic monohydrogen phosphate.
